What Exactly is a Teddy Bear Puppy?

Teddy Bear puppies happen to be a quite recent type of dog, having only existed since the late 1990's. The specific label “Teddy Bear” doesn’t formally relate to one specific particular breed, but is most frequently deployed in descriptions of the cross breed of a Bichon Frise with a Shih Tzu. At the same time, the term “Teddy Bear” is actually frequently used to refer to a number of hybrids within breeds including: Toy Poodles, Shih Tzu, Bichon Frise, Yorkshire Terriers, Cocker Spaniels, Dachshunds, and Schnauzer's.
The Shih Tzu/Bichon Frise cross is also popularly known as a Tzu Frise, Shichon, or Zuchon. This unique version of designer dog has obtained the label “Teddy Bear” due to their small overall size, dainty features, fuzzy hair, sizeable eyes, and general similarity to a teddy bear.
Buddy the Teddy Bear PuppyTeddy Bears are certainly not a officially recognized breed of canine within the AKC. Interestingly however, it is possible that with a handful of additional generations of breeding they are going to receive that worldwide recognition under the name: Zuchon.
Teddy Bear dogs can potentially grow to be nearly 20 lbs., but commonly weigh somewhere between 11-16 after fully grown. They may be a combination of unique colors consisting of white, black, as well as several different hues of brown. This coloring adds to their attractiveness amidst puppy owners simply because two Teddy Bears very rarely look completely alike.
Teddy's are extremely loyal dogs and love physical contact. It is absolutely not abnormal for any Teddy to take a midday snooze in your lap, or at your feet. They generally get along perfectly with other household pets, particularly any other dogs, and are also wonderful for young children. Not surprisingly, they started out actually being carefully bred to be therapy dogs for individuals with handicaps. Their modest disposition ensures they are an excellent pet for almost everyone. They usually do not typically bark, although they definitely will bark whenever they sense danger, and also when someone new enters into their home for the first time.
Most teddy bears are also hypo-allergenic, making them perfect for a person with an allergy problem. They have typically been bred to produce almost no dander, for this reason even if you're sensitive to most dogs, a Teddy might be ideal for you!
Mini Teddy Bear Puppies
Mini Teddy Bear puppies are an even more recent form of cross breed coming from a Maltese and a Shih Tzu. They are very similar to the full sized Teddy's regarding their attitude, appearance, and temperament, and have also been selectively bred to be hypo-allergenic to boot. Similar to their normal sized cousins, they're wonderful with additional pets and children.
Mini Teddy Bears typically only weigh at maturity approximately 9-12 lbs. and continue to retain their puppy qualities during their whole entire lives. They could be the ideal dog for anyone who never wants their puppy to appear like they have grown up!
Mini Teddy bear’s have a smaller sized physique, big floppy ears, a mashed in face and big deep set eyes. They come in many different colors, and just like the traditionally sized Teddy’s they characteristically have numerous colors in their coat, rendering each Mini Teddy completely unique.
